`(IE)_1` and `(IE)_2` of `Mg_((g))` are 740, 1540 kJ `mol^(-1)` . Calculate percentage of `Mg_((g))^(+)` and `Mg_((g))^(2+)` if 1 g of `Mg_((s))` absorbs 50.0 kJ of energy.

A

`%Mg^+` = 70% %`Mg^(+2)` = 30%

B

%`Mg^+` =68.35% %`Mg^(+2)` = 31.65%

C

% `Mg^(+)` = 72% %`Mg^(+2)` = 28%

D

%`Mg^+` = 60% % `Mg^(+2)` = 40%

Text Solution

Verified by Experts

The correct Answer is:
B
